I Was Just Thinking - Essays from the Edge of All Light From its obscure and timid debut in a monthly neighborhood newsletter in January 1990 to a successful decade long run in a Northeast Georgia community paper, the column, I was Just Thinking, spanned a total of more than fifteen years quietly probing those small questions and issues that most curious souls ponder but rarely speak aloud; life, death, time, lies, truth, weeds, plastic food saver lids and other weighty conundrums. As determined by reader response, this collection represents the best of hundreds of essays. It also includes the author's personal favorites. Sometimes funny, often poignant, these deep explorations into the minutia of human experience often conclude with unexpected answers that anyone can take to heart.
